Countdown to UFC 126 premieres Wednesday night on Spike at 7:00 p.m ET; Thursday morning on UFC.com:
Anderson Silva: "Before the fight, fighters can say whatever they want. A parrot can say he can sing like a canary, but once you get inside the Octagon it all changes. That's what I'm training for, to go there and win, but only God knows."
Vitor Belfort: "The beginning is easy. The thing is to finish the race. I have the ability, I have the talent; I have everything I can do to beat him up. The plan is to defeat him, for sure."
Forrest Griffin: "This is a huge fight because I have not won a fight in a year. If I want to do this, if I want to be in this game and be on the big cards then I need to win a fight."
Rich Franklin: "Preparing for this fight is no different than preparing for a fight that I had 5 years ago. Get in the gym, I bust my butt and I work hard. I out work other people, that's how I win."
Jon Jones: "You're going to see the skinny kid defend himself against the bull and I think that is going to be awesome to watch. I feel 100% that I've already won this fight."
Ryan Bader: "I think the best way to stop the Jon Jones hype train is to leave him laying on the mat."
